Compare all specifications:
1989 Daihatsu Charade | 1984 Talbot 1510 | |
Make | Daihatsu | Talbot |
Model | Charade | 1510 |
Year Released | 1989 | 1984 |
Engine Size | 1295 cc | 1905 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 90 HP | 63 HP |
Torque | 101 Nm | 120 Nm |
Torque RPM | 5500 RPM | 2000 RPM |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 808 kg | 1080 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3610 mm | 4320 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1620 mm | 1690 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1400 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2350 mm | 2610 mm |
